Location
The Urban Shed is located in the centre of Cambridge along the busy thoroughfare of King Street close to both Market Square, the Grafton Centre, Christ Pieces and Midsummer Common. King Street is an established retail and leisure pitch with nearby occupiers including The Cambridge Brewhouse, St Radegund, D'Arrys, and The King Street Run.
Property
The Urban Shedis a lockup unit with internal trading area and rear deckedgarden. The trading area is all situated at ground floor level and consists of c.20 internal covers. This is supported by a servery with well-equipped kitchen behind.
The rear trade garden incorporates 12-15 covers and a further storage area to support the kitchen.
Tenure
The property isheld on afull repairing and insuring (FRI) lease held from Christ's College from 20th November 2015 for a termof 10 years, subject to a rent review in 2020.
The passing rent is14,000 per annum, exclusive of VAT.
